How Finasteride vs Minoxidil Actually Works
Finasteride and minoxidil work in different ways to address hair loss. Finasteride, a 5-alpha-reductase inhibitor, slows down hair follicle shrinkage by blocking the con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T), a hormone linked to hair loss. Minoxidil, on the other hand, widens blood vessels and increases blood flow to the scalp, promoting hair growth and preventing further hair loss.

What Are the Side Effects of Finasteride?
Finasteride can cause mild side effects, such as decreased libido and erectile dysfunction. These symptoms are often temporary and may subside once treatment is stopped.
Can I Use Minoxidil with Finasteride?
Using both treatments together can be effective, but it's essential to consult a doctor before combining them.

Are Finasteride and Minoxidil Safe?
Both treatments are generally safe when used as directed. However, finasteride may not be suitable for women or children.
